I currently have very important information in a floppy disc that i need to move to my computer. Now, it's old and might be scratched, but i try anyway.
I open "My Documents" and "My Computer".
I tile both windows vertically so i see both windows.
I open my A drive window.
I wait for a while, and a window pops up saying "You need to format the disc. Do you want to format?"

My question is: If i format it, do i lose my information? I cannot lose it! I know it's still there, since I've seen it. Yet I don't know if formating will affect it. Someone please help!!!

I've read the help and it says it will delete. However, is there any way that you can access or format a disc without losig my data? I NEED TO SAVE THE DATA!!!
 
Formatting WILL wipe it clean. Sounds like the floppy disk is bad, or you
have a bad or dirty drive. Do any other floppys work in the drive? Possibly
try the disk in another computer to test floppy disk. That's all I can think
of.
